module.exports = new class { constructor() { this.argGens = { 'napi_string': this.genString, 'napi_int32': this.genInt32, 'napi_uint32': this.genUint32, 'napi_int64': this.genInt64, 'napi_uint64': this.genInt64, 'napi_external': this.genExternal, } } getGen(napiType) { if(this.argGens[napiType] == null) { throw new Error(`GenImplArgs does not support napi_type ${napiType}`); } return this.argGens[napiType]; } genString(arg, idx) { return ` size_t arg${idx}_len; status = napi_get_value_string_utf8(env, args[${idx}], NULL, 0, &arg${idx}_len); assert(status == napi_ok); char arg${idx}[arg${idx}_len+1]; status = napi_get_value_string_utf8(env, args[${idx}], arg${idx}, sizeof(arg${idx}), NULL); assert(status == napi_ok); `; } genInt32(arg, idx) { return ` ${arg.type} arg${idx} = 0; status = napi_get_value_int32(env, args[${idx}], &arg${idx}); assert(status == napi_ok); `; } genUint32(arg, idx) { return ` ${arg.type} arg${idx} = 0; status = napi_get_value_uint32(env, args[${idx}], &arg${idx}); assert(status == napi_ok); `; } genInt64(arg, idx) { return ` ${arg.type} arg${idx} = 0; status = napi_get_value_int64(env, args[${idx}], (int64_t *)&arg${idx}); assert(status == napi_ok); `; } genExternal(arg, idx) { return ` ${arg.type} arg${idx} = NULL; status = napi_get_value_external(env, args[${idx}], (void**)&arg${idx}); assert(status == napi_ok); `; } };
